Description: 19th. century Persian Jewish altar in form of a mirror. The gates of the sacred arch altar are hand-painted on gesso featuring birds and flowers and open to reveal an interior mirror. The inscription on the mirror are reverse painted and represent 6 Hebrew names. This is a very rare artifact of religious importance to Sephardic Jewish cultural inheritance. Size: 19" X 13.8" (48 X 35 cm.).
